KPA Acquires Environmental Risk Management & Safety, Inc.

New acquisition combined with national footprint strengthens KPA’s role as a leader in EHS risk management.

KPA Services, LLC, a leader in environmental health and safety (EHS) risk management, has announced the acquisition of Environmental Risk Management & Safety, Inc. (ERS). The acquisition closed on March 29, 2018.

Through the merging of two strong client bases and expanding its EHS solutions, this transaction strengthens KPA’s position as the leading provider of EHS risk management services to the automotive market.

KPA is a leader in cloud-based EHS risk management solutions and closed-loop, on-site audit services that proactively mitigate potential accidents and the costly ramifications of non-compliance with state and federal EHS regulations. In addition to EHS, KPA’s comprehensive automotive solution covers operational workflow as well as regulatory risks associated with finance and insurance (F&I) and human capital management (HCM). The company focuses on mid-market companies in automotive, manufacturing, distribution and logistics, and insurance.

ERS provides EHS compliance solutions to clients in multiple industries throughout the nation, with concentration in the southern U.S. Their current services complement KPA and reinforce KPA’s presence in the collision and auto dealer EHS markets.

“This acquisition not only accelerates KPA’s strategy to deepen our showroom to shop compliance expertise in the automotive market, it enhances our efforts in adjacent target markets,” said Vane Clayton, CEO of KPA.
